Download Kakao T right before your night out. It?�s Korea?�s trip-hailing app and your lifeline after midnight when subways near.
Flip faraway from elders when drinking. If another person older pours you a consume, turn your head a little towards the aspect prior to getting a sip. It?�s a sign of respect.

Noraebang: no Korean night out is full without the need of it No Korean night out is full without the need of noraebang (?�래�?, which literally signifies ?�singing home.??Not like Western karaoke bars, Korean noraebangs offer you a private area with all your group ??no singing in front of strangers.
